HomeVyOS Platform

T6121: Extend service config-sync to new sections

This commit has been deleted in the repository: it is no longer reachable from any branch, tag, or ref.

Description

T6121: Extend service config-sync to new sections

Extend service config-sync with new sections:

  • LeafNodes: pki, policy, vpn, vrf (syncs the whole sections)
  • Nodes: interfaces, protocols, service (syncs subsections)

In this cae the Node allows to uses the next level section
i.e subsection

For example any of the subsection of the node interfaces:

  • set service config-sync section interfaces pseudo-ethernet
  • set service config-sync section interfaces virtual-ethernet

Example of the config:

set service config-sync mode 'load'
set service config-sync secondary address '192.0.2.1'
set service config-sync secondary key 'xxx'
set service config-sync section firewall
set service config-sync section interfaces pseudo-ethernet
set service config-sync section interfaces virtual-ethernet
set service config-sync section nat
set service config-sync section nat66
set service config-sync section protocols static
set service config-sync section pki
set service config-sync section vrf

(cherry picked from commit 25b611f504521181f85cb4460bfdfd702c377b5e)

Details

Provenance
ViacheslavAuthored on Mar 14 2024, 1:32 PM
MergifyCommitted on Mar 18 2024, 10:22 AM
Parents
rVYOSONEX42f3b83dd898: Merge pull request #3142 from vyos/mergify/bp/sagitta/pr-3139
Branches
Loading...
Tags
Loading...

Event Timeline